Financial modeling is truly an artwork form. Good writers draw on the broad vocabulary to locate the appropriate phrase to communicate their Tips. A good money modeler really should be proficient in employing many different functions making sure that she or he can closely mirror the behavior of a business’s economic statements in a economical product. Let us Have a look at a handful of features that each fiscal modeler ought to know.

The vast majority of economic modeling can be carried out with the fundamental arithmetic operators (+ – x /), but there is also a big number of organization logic that can’t be quickly illustrated without having incorporating other functions.

The IF function

Let’s say, such as, that we have modeled out an money assertion, but we want to insert a dividend payment. If we don’t have adequate net income available to spend out a dividend (and don’t desire to attract funds from our retained earnings), we don’t need to pay a dividend. If we do have more than enough net cash flow available, we would like to pay out a $0.ten for every share dividend to traders.

This can be a perfect destination to use Excel’s IF purpose. The IF perform evaluates a specific situation and returns a single value Should the ailment is genuine and Yet another benefit Should the situation is false. Inside our situation, the functionality would study as follows:

=IF(net income < dividend payment x # of shares, 0, dividend payment x # of shares)

Precisely, “net cash flow” would reference the cell in which Internet earnings is calculated. The “dividend payment” would reference a mobile that contains the worth from the dividend payment, along with the “# of shares” would reference a cell the includes the volume of shares superb.

The “0” enter value is the value that is certainly returned When the ailment is accurate. That is certainly, if Web earnings is a lot less than the whole quantity of dividends which might be to generally be compensated, then we won’t pay out a dividend.

Lastly, When the assertion will not be real, and You can find adequate Web earnings to pay for a dividend, We’ll return the amount of the dividend to become compensated (a cell referencing the dividend payment amount multiplied by a mobile referencing the quantity of remarkable shares).

This is just one illustration of how the IF perform might be used in a monetary model. This purpose might be important for just about any design that requires conditional logic and it is applied fairly frequently.

The VLOOKUP and HLOOKUP features

Now for instance we have made a economical product through which We now have a selection off assumptions, and we wish to develop many various situations that contain distinctive assumptions. In lieu of switching the assumptions every time we wish to examine a unique scenario, we can easily make a table of assumptions that come with all of our situations.

The main column on the table would comprise the state of affairs – scenario 1, situation two, and so forth. The next columns would contain Every single assumption to the model combined with the corresponding values that needs to be Utilized in Every single situation.

To pull these values into our product, we will use the VLOOKUP function. Based on the orientation of your information, you can use the VLOOKUP or HLOOKUP functions to grab facts from the table determined by a price from the primary row or column from the desk. Because we put the situation in the initial column of our details, we will use the VLOOKUP operate as the purpose will utilize the vertical orientation of our information to lookup values.

Initial, we will develop an assumption cell that could incorporate our scenario. During this mobile, we are going to set “situation 1” for a placeholder. Upcoming we will set the following functionality of in the assumption mobile of every of our assumptions:

=VLOOKUP(situation, assumption table array, column quantity of assumption, Bogus)

“Situation” will consult with the state of affairs assumption mobile we just made. By changing the worth Within this mobile, We’ll now have the capacity to alter the all values for each of our scenarios at the same time. The “assumption table array” might be a reference to all the cells contained from the assumptions table we established. This can tell the functionality the place to lookup our values.

The “column variety” refers back to the column with the desk which contains the belief that we wish. By way of example, in order to pull the idea in the column proper following the state of affairs column, you’d probably set two as it is the next column. The “Untrue” worth in the last enter with the purpose refers to The truth that we want an exact match of the value from our state of affairs assumption mobile and the value within the circumstance column of our desk.

Now we will change the value inside our state of affairs cell and all of our assumptions will immediately update to that scenario. This is only one use of the VLOOKUP and HLOOKUP features, but it really illustrates the concept behind them.

The ability to immediately reference a selected value in the desk delivers the strength of a small database into a spreadsheet and can lead to significant efficiencies for financial modeling.

The INDIRECT function

A further purpose that really opens up doorways in monetary types and helps you to form info in spreadsheets normally would be the INDIRECT functionality. The Oblique functionality uses values within cells to construct a cell reference. As an example, if mobile A1 includes the worth “B5,” as well as mobile B5 incorporates the value “$one hundred,” then the function Oblique(A1) would cause the worth $100.

In the beginning blush, this functionality may appear inconsequentially. Why not only reference mobile B5 right? But Let’s say we must pull values from various worksheets inside of a model?

Let’s assume We now have a model that initiatives a corporations future revenue statements determined by its most up-to-date earnings statement. We want to pull the values from the actual earnings assertion with a individual worksheet tab and make use of them within our model to forecast new statements.

Every time the corporation places out a new money assertion, we would have to duplicate and paste The brand new values into our design. In order to avoid this tiresome procedure, we can make use of the Oblique operate to seize the values off the new monetary assertion just by incorporating The brand new assertion as a worksheet in our product and modifying the value in only one mobile.

Here’s how it may function. Produce a single input cell that would reference your most up-to-date fiscal assertion and set “2010” during the mobile like a placeholder. For that 2010, financial assertion worksheet, make certain the tab is named “2010” (Be aware that using Areas in worksheet names will require you to implement single prices throughout the identify of the worksheet in a very formulation reference).

Then for each price within our product in which we must reference a worth on the particular economic assertion, we make use of the INDIRECT function. As an instance which the profits price is contained in cell D8 around the 2010 economical statement worksheet and our enter mobile for that worksheet is in A5. We’d create the next purpose:


Excel will interpret this purpose as being a reference that appears like this:


This tends to pull the profits price within the “2010” worksheet from cell D8. We would use an identical perform for the many remaining values that we have to pull, changing “D8” with the right mobile reference to the financial statement worksheet.

Assuming that every one fiscal statements for the corporate follow the very same format, we can now simply update the model for the 2011 financials. We basically copy them into a new worksheet inside our design and rename the worksheet “2011.” We then improve our enter cell to “2011,” as well as the INDIRECT operate will now pull each of the values within the “2011” worksheet as an alternative to the “2010.”

There are actually of course numerous ways to go about solving these varieties of challenges, but these features will provide a monetary modeler some crucial applications for tackling them. There are several ways that the IF, VLOOKUP/HLOOKUP and INDIRECT capabilities can be utilized to drag jointly data in economical designs along with other spreadsheet initiatives. They will even be employed alongside one another to carry out some very incredible feats.

Take into account that monetary modeling is undoubtedly an art form, and you’ve got to think creatively to think of effective solutions for modeling economical relationships. The more features that you’re knowledgeable about, the more creatively and successfully you may go about acquiring these solutions.

Want to look at some sample money versions [] relevant to these capabilities?